Closed Bug 716255 Opened 13 years ago Closed 12 years ago

10x regression when using lots of switches

Categories

(Core :: JavaScript Engine, defect)

defect
Not set
normal

Tracking

()

RESOLVED WORKSFORME

People

(Reporter: azakai, Unassigned)

References

Details

Attachments

(1 file)

      No description provided.
Attached file testcase (zlib)
This testcase has become 10x slower with 83343:eaac85c4c05f

http://hg.mozilla.org/mozilla-central/rev/eaac85c4c05f

The regression is with |-m -n|. I guess this is because of additional analysis now done in switches. The bug mentions that bug 709614 will help here.
Blocks: 704387
Depends on: 706914
Err, that should have been bug 706914 in the last comment, sorry (I did get the "depends on" right though ;)
Bug 706914 has landed, but seems to not help here.
This appears to not be an issue anymore. -n makes it 17% slower but at least not 10x.
Status: NEW → RESOLVED
Closed: 12 years ago
Resolution: --- → FIXED
Resolution: FIXED → WORKSFORME
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: